Temtex™ fabrics are temperature-resistant fabrics, from 100 to 2000 gram/m², either in loom state, caramelized or treated/ coated with silicone, poly-urethane, alu-foil and high-temp treatment. Temtex™ fabrics are made from non-hazardous continuous-filament E-glass (or silica) fibres. Webb27 feb. 2024 · What are Technical Fibers Used For?
